			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I think <a href="http://www.nbc.com/Saturday_Night_Live/">SNL</a> had a pretty serious break-through last night (and no, I&#8217;m not talking about <a href="http://www.amy-poehler.net/">Poehler&#8217;s</a> return, though I adore her).  I am talking about the <a href="http://www.chroniclebooks.com/index/main,book-info/store,books/products_id,2878/path,1-42-25/title,Blue-Note/">Blue-Note-riff</a> that <a href="http://www.hulu.com/watch/47605/saturday-night-live-obama-plays-it-cool">SNL did</a> on President-elect Obama.</p>

<p>As a comedy writer, you really don&#8217;t have to work that hard when your President says things like &#8220;I didn&#8217;t grow up in the ocean&#8212;as a matter of fact&#8212;near the ocean&#8212;I grew up in the desert. Therefore, it was a pleasant contrast to see the ocean. And I particularly like it when I&#8217;m fishing.&#8221; And he says things like this so frequently that &#8220;<a href="http://politicalhumor.about.com/library/blbushisms.htm">Bushism</a>,&#8221; has made its way in to common usage in English.</p>

<p>It&#8217;s tough to pick on someone who is seriously calculating about what he says and does and good evidence that SNL writers understand that&#8212;so make fun of the calculating! Maybe not everyone watching is familiar with the graphics reference in the video, but it&#8217;s a direct quote from Blue Note Records and the covers of albums by jazz musicians like Miles Davis. You want to talk about cool?&#8212;jazz is where the very word&#8217;s origins lie.</p>

<p>Fred Armisen&#8217;s imitation of Barrack Obama has been steadily improving.  And while this sketch doesn&#8217;t top the 3 o&#8217;clock in the morning call when <a href="http://rawstory.com/news/2008/SNL_spoofs_Hillarys_3AM_phone_call_0309.html">&#8220;President&#8221; Obama loses his cool</a>, you have to give SNL credit.<sup id="fnref:1"><a href="#fn:1" rel="footnote">1</a></sup> They figured out an angle of comedy here that no other comedy writers had thought of&#8212;in two years&#8212;it shows real creative talent whatever their critics say.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Obama transition team launched this new web site, <a href="http://change.gov/">Change.gov</a> in order to keep the public informed on the transition team&#8217;s decisions and news.  They are also soliciting information from the public&#8212;so go tell them what you think!  I, for one, think that this web site, among other statements that President-elect Obama has made about making government transparent is a fantastic sign of things to come.<sup id="fnref:1"><a href="#fn:1" rel="footnote">1</a></sup>  Take a look at the current <a href="http://whitehouse.gov">White House web site</a> and try to imagine what it&#8217;s going to look in the next year&#8212;a new generation is what.  Given the large amount of importance that online efforts played in the President-elect&#8217;s campaign, I think we can expect it to play a large role in his administration.</p>
